2 Kings 8:25
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
In the twelfth year of Joram son of Ahab king of Israel, did Ahaziah son of Jehoram king of Judah, begin to reign.
2 Kings 8:26
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
Two and twenty years old, was Ahaziah when he began to reign, - and, one year, reigned he in Jerusalem, - and, his mother's name, was Athaliah, daughter of Omri, king of Israel;
2 Kings 8:27
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And he walked in the way of the house of Ahab, and did the thing that was wicked in the eyes of Yahweh, like the house of Ahab, - for, son-in-law of the house of Ahab, was, he.
2 Kings 8:28
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And he went with Joram son of Ahab, to make war against Hazael king of Syria, in Ramoth-gilead, - and the Syrians wounded Joram.
2 Kings 8:29
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
So Joram the king returned to get healed in Jezreel, from the wounds wherewith the Syrians had wounded him in Ramah, when he fought with Hazael king of Syria, - and, Ahaziah son of Jehoram king of Judah, went down to see Joram son of Ahab in Jezreel, because he, was sick.
